怎么用mongodb导入数据库文件
- 行业动态
- 2024-05-29
- 2
使用MongoDB导入数据库文件通常涉及以下几个步骤:
1、准备数据文件
2、安装和配置MongoDB
3、创建数据库和集合
4、导入数据
5、验证数据
1. 准备数据文件
确保你有一个或多个符合MongoDB支持的格式的数据文件,常见的格式包括JSON、CSV和XML。
JSON: 每个文档一个行,每行一个JSON对象。
CSV: 表格数据,可以使用mongoimport工具导入。
XML: 需要转换为JSON或CSV格式。
2. 安装和配置MongoDB
在开始导入之前,你需要在你的机器上安装MongoDB,你可以从MongoDB官网下载安装程序并按照指南进行安装。
3. 创建数据库和集合
在MongoDB中,数据被组织成数据库和集合(类似于关系型数据库中的表)。
创建数据库: 使用use命令创建一个新数据库。
“`mongodb
use myDatabase
“`
创建集合: 集合会在你插入第一个文档时自动创建。
4. 导入数据
使用mongoimport工具将数据导入到MongoDB中,这个工具可以解析JSON和CSV文件,并将数据插入到你指定的数据库和集合中。
JSON: 如果你有一个名为data.json的文件,你可以使用以下命令导入它:
“`bash
mongoimport db myDatabase collection myCollection file data.json
“`
CSV: 如果你有一个名为data.csv的文件,你可以使用以下命令导入它:
“`bash
mongoimport db myDatabase collection myCollection type csv headerline file data.csv
“`
5. 验证数据
导入数据后,你应该验证数据是否正确地存储在数据库中,你可以使用MongoDB shell来查询和检查数据。
查询数据: 使用find命令查看集合中的所有文档。
“`mongodb
db.myCollection.find()
“`
检查数据: 确保数据的结构、类型和值都符合预期。
通过以上步骤,你可以使用MongoDB导入数据库文件,确保在导入之前备份你的数据,以防任何意外发生。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/63713.html